Understanding Furfuryl Methyl Sulfide: Properties and Applications
Furfuryl Methyl Sulfide, identified by its CAS number 1438-91-1, is a chemical compound that has garnered significant attention in the food and flavor industry. As a key aroma compound, it contributes desirable nutty and caramel-like notes, making it a valuable ingredient for formulators seeking to enhance the sensory profiles of various products. Understanding its properties and applications is essential for procurement professionals and food scientists alike.
Chemically, Furfuryl Methyl Sulfide has the molecular formula C6H8OS and is also known by synonyms such as 2-((Methylthio)methyl)furan. Its molecular weight is approximately 128.19 g/mol. Physically, it presents as a clear liquid, typically ranging in color from yellow to green or light brown. This visual characteristic, combined with its distinct aroma, makes it a recognizable component in flavor creation.
The primary applications for Furfuryl Methyl Sulfide are found within the food industry, particularly in the development of flavors for baked goods, beverages, and confectionery. Its ability to impart warm, roasted, and sweet caramel notes makes it ideal for products such as bread, cookies, candies, and various cold drinks. The consistent purity, often specified at 99% minimum, ensures its efficacy and reliability in these sensitive applications.
